X-ray detection of coal gangue high-pressure gas spraying sorting system: convenient and fast implementation of automatic identification of coal gangue



With the rapid development of the coal industry, the issue of processing and utilizing coal gangue is becoming increasingly prominent. Traditional coal gangue sorting methods often suffer from low efficiency and high misjudgment rates, which cannot meet the needs of large-scale and efficient processing. Therefore, developing a convenient and fast automatic identification system for coal gangue has become an urgent task. In recent years, the combination of X-ray detection technology and high-pressure gas jet sorting systems has provided a new solution for the automatic identification of coal gangue.
X-ray detection technology utilizes the different penetrability of X-rays to substances, which can achieve precise identification of the internal components of coal gangue. By capturing and analyzing the attenuation of X-rays passing through coal gangue, information such as density and atomic number of different components in coal gangue can be obtained, thereby achieving accurate classification of coal gangue. The application of this technology has greatly improved the accuracy and reliability of coal gangue sorting.

The high-pressure gas jet sorting system is a sorting device based on the principle of high-pressure gas jet. It achieves precise sorting of coal gangue by controlling the direction and intensity of high-pressure gas injection based on the results of X-ray detection. When the X-ray detection system identifies different components in coal gangue, the high-pressure gas jet sorting system quickly responds by sending different types of coal gangue into different collection devices, thereby achieving rapid sorting of coal gangue.

The combination of X-ray detection and high-pressure air jet sorting system not only improves the efficiency and accuracy of coal gangue sorting, but also reduces the need for manual intervention. The traditional method of sorting coal gangue often requires a large amount of manual operation, which is not only labor-intensive but also easily influenced by human factors, leading to unstable sorting results. The use of X-ray detection and high-pressure air jet sorting system can achieve automated and continuous sorting of coal gangue, greatly improving sorting efficiency, reducing labor costs, and also improving the stability and reliability of sorting.
